Our Solution

As part of the process, GALOSI met with key personnel within the company and collected and organized all raw data pertaining to the audit, a process called “download management.” This is a vital step to ensure a smooth transition of all data. GALOSI worked diligently to coordinate their team with the client’s employees during this process where paper data must be copied, sorted, and filed, paper-based data needs to be converted to electronic data and downloads from clients need to be analyzed and converted into database files suitable for auditing. As part of GALOSI’s process, they used the raw data with the client’s A/P infrastructure and processes to create customized software that mimics the client’s internal processes to ease the transition to auditing, allowing GALOSI to focus on the data.

After the initial analysis of the Vendor Funding Programs, GALOSI provided their findings with detailed documentation that supported the proposed recoveries.  Upon review of the findings, the client agreed with GALOSI’s recommendations. GALOSI proceeded to contact vendors on the client’s behalf to efficiently conduct this communication and collection phase in the profit recovery process.
